TLDR: Mark Cuban's Cost Plus Drugs would have provided an estimated $1.29 billion reduction in 2020 costs if they replaced the Medicare prices on just 9 drugs alone.

Literally one drug was $22.48 on Cost Plus vs. $293.66 through Medicare Part D.
